The Beginning and Right to Stay Challenge

That trip was probably the longest three hours Apollo had ever gone through. Apollo is normally the social, cocky, Mr. Popular kind of guy. But this time, he had turned off the chariot and was out of the car before it even came to a complete stop. It must've been very loud, even traumatic for him because right when his feet hit the ground he got as far away from the group as he could and just paced back and forth for at least an hour. He came back once to whine to Artemis (who had also come to visit) until she gave him Tylenol. Then he just went back to where he was at and fell asleep in the sand.

By the time the contestants unloaded their luggage it was time for lunch. They piled their bags up near a tree and headed over to the picnic area to eat. The chef had made hotdogs and burgers, and everyone started scarfing it down. It was gone in a matter of minutes. They were all just talking and trying to let their food settle, when Chiron trotted in.

After a bunch of fail attempts, he finally got everyone's attention.

"Is everyone enjoying themselves so far?" Everyone nodded. "Good, because all this will come to an end for two of you within the next hour. Follow me outside."

All the campers got up and nervously followed him. They shortly arrived at what looked like a floating set of monkey bars. Apollo must've felt better because he followed along with Artemis and the rest.

"This will be your first challenge and for some of you…your last. We call it hang, simply because that's what you do. You will all climb up the ladders on the sides of the bars and hang on them as long as you can. The only rule is that you can hang on to the bars with your hands only. No hanging upside down! The first two to fall will grab their bags and ride back to camp with Apollo tonight. The person who hangs on the longest will choose the first team, then the first team will pick the second theam, and so on."

He paused and looked at the campers. "I hope you discussed who you wanted for a partner at lunch, because there is no trading."

There were a few "yes's" and "we did's", but mostly everyone just looked nervous.

"Okay then. Get in position, and good luck." Everyone waded through the water, climbed up either of the four ladders on the corners, and grabbed onto the bars. Then Chiron started the timer and they just hung there…
